Register for a class at GK Digital

Next Step

How would you like to pay for your class?
Pay by credit card Pay with prepaid coupon

Class Details


$375 USD
Complimentary Subscription:
15 weeks access to entire library
15 days (starts first day of class - omits weekends)
Start Date:
Monday, February 25, 2013
End Date:
Tuesday, March 12, 2013

Class Details:

Essential C# is our comprehensive C# course. It is designed to take developers who are new to C# and .NET and get them up to speed on all but the most advanced C# topics.

As you may realize, knowing C# is only the beginning for developing in .NET. Once you understand the language, you need to pick and learn a platform. Popular choices include WPF, Windows Forms, Windows 8 Apps, ASP.NET Web Forms, or ASP.NET MVC (which powers LearningLine).

That said, this course will provide a very solid foundation for any .NET platform you choose going forward. Just some of the topics include:

  • Getting started with Visual Studio
  • Basic I/O
  • Using code in other assemblies (class libraries)
  • Creating and calling methods
  • Consuming and building classes
  • Working with properties
  • Error handling and exceptions
  • Enumerations
  • Reference types and value types
  • Generics
  • Object inheritance
  • Attributes and reflection